About [(2S)-1-docosanoyloxy-3-[(Z)-tetracos-15-enoyl]oxypropan-2-yl] tetracosanoate

[(2S)-1-docosanoyloxy-3-[(Z)-tetracos-15-enoyl]oxypropan-2-yl] tetracosanoate (PubChem CID 131757339) has the molecular formula C73H140O6 and a molecular weight of 1113.92 g/mol. Its IUPAC name is [(2S)-1-docosanoyloxy-3-[(Z)-tetracos-15-enoyl]oxypropan-2-yl] tetracosanoate.
